MePDCL yet to clear Rs 20-lakh chopper bill to Transport dept

Date:

Share post:

SHILLONG, June 2: A pending bill amounting to over Rs 20 lakh against hiring of helicopter for official tours by the then Power Minister, James PK Sangma has come to light.
DD Shira, Joint Secretary of Power department, reportedly wrote a letter to the Director (Distribution) of Meghalaya Power Distribution Corporation Limited (MePDCL) with the subject “helicopter bill” mentioning that the Transport department has submitted a bill amounting to Rs 20,82,208 against official tour of the then Power Minister (James).
The letter states that if there is no fund available under the concerned head of accounts, the MePDCL should locate savings from any other head and clear the dues.
The authenticity of the letter could not be independently verified by The Shillong Times.
